feat: default locale Russian, geo determines language for other countries
- localization-svc: defaultLocale ru, resolveLocale only by geo - web-svc: DEFAULT_LOCALE ru, layout lang=ru, embeddedTranslations fallback ru - countryToLocale: default ru when no country or unknown country Co-authored-by: Cursor <cursoragent@cursor.com>
This commit is contained in:
8
services/library-svc/drizzle/0000_init.sql
Normal file
8
services/library-svc/drizzle/0000_init.sql
Normal file
@@ -0,0 +1,8 @@
|
||||
CREATE TABLE IF NOT EXISTS library_threads (
|
||||
id TEXT PRIMARY KEY,
|
||||
user_id TEXT NOT NULL,
|
||||
title TEXT NOT NULL,
|
||||
created_at TIMESTAMP DEFAULT NOW() NOT NULL,
|
||||
sources JSONB DEFAULT '[]',
|
||||
files JSONB DEFAULT '[]'
|
||||
);
|
||||
13
services/library-svc/drizzle/0001_thread_messages.sql
Normal file
13
services/library-svc/drizzle/0001_thread_messages.sql
Normal file
@@ -0,0 +1,13 @@
|
||||
CREATE TABLE IF NOT EXISTS library_thread_messages (
|
||||
id SERIAL PRIMARY KEY,
|
||||
thread_id TEXT NOT NULL REFERENCES library_threads(id) ON DELETE CASCADE,
|
||||
message_id TEXT NOT NULL,
|
||||
backend_id TEXT NOT NULL DEFAULT '',
|
||||
query TEXT NOT NULL,
|
||||
created_at TIMESTAMP DEFAULT NOW() NOT NULL,
|
||||
response_blocks JSONB DEFAULT '[]',
|
||||
status TEXT DEFAULT 'answering'
|
||||
);
|
||||
|
||||
CREATE UNIQUE INDEX IF NOT EXISTS idx_thread_messages_thread_message
|
||||
ON library_thread_messages(thread_id, message_id);
|
||||
Reference in New Issue
Block a user